In a mixing bowl, combine the ground beef,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, black pepper, and smoked paprika. Mix until well blended, but do not overwork the meat.
Divide the meat mixture into 4 equal portions and shape each portion into a patty about ¾ inch thick, making a slight indentation in the center to help them cook evenly.
Preheat the air fryer to 360°F (182°C) for about 5 minutes.
Lightly spray the air fryer basket with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
Place the patties in a single layer in the air fryer basket, ensuring they do not touch. You may need to cook in batches, depending on the size of your air fryer.
Cook the burgers for 12 minutes, flipping halfway through the cooking time. Use a meat thermometer to check that the internal temperature reaches 160°F (71°C) for medium doneness.
If adding cheese, place a slice on each patty during the last 2 minutes of cooking to allow it to melt.
Once cooked, remove the hamburgers from the air fryer and let them rest for a couple of minutes.
Assemble the hamburgers by placing each patty on a bun and adding your desired toppings. Serve immediately.
